What is Eyebrow Waxing? -

Hundreds of years ago, concoctions of creams and waxes were commonly produced and used. Waxes were usually a creation produced from various oils and honeys that were warmed up, placed on area of unwanted hair, and then lifted to remove the unwanted hairs. Waxing has developed over the years to its most current state. 

Waxing is considered a semi-permanent hair removal. Even though the hair is lifted from the root, it will grow back in a few weeks. The area is generally hair free for up to eight weeks. 

Today, eyebrow waxing can be done at most beauty salons in New York. Today's version is simpler to the concoctions of the past, but gentler on the skin. The waxing method of hair removal is quick, produces results, and is a lot less painful than other eyebrow maintenance techniques like plucking. 

How is Eyebrow Waxing performed? -

A typical eyebrow waxing session in New York starts when the client lies down in a chair. The client is asked to close their eyes while the eyebrows are cleansed and a talc powder is applied to the area that is going to be waxed. The wax is then spread over the hair that is going to be removed with a wooden stick.

A piece of fabric with a sticky backing is then placed over the wax. The strip is smoothed and pressed onto the wax before gently being lifted. The skin is held firmly in place to alleviate some of the pain when the strip is lifted. The procedure may sometimes need to be repeated for optimal results. A soothing cream is then applied to the area that was waxed.

What are the benefits and drawbacks of Eyebrow Waxing? -

Eyebrow waxing has its benefits. For starters, a large amount of hair is removed at one time instead of one hair at a time like plucking. Secondly, the hair is removed directly from the root, which impedes its growth. Removal methods that remove hair only at the surface areas will typically see regrowth in a few days.

A less painful solution to removing hair that keeps the area hairless for longer seems like the ideal hair removal method. Some drawbacks do exist to eyebrow waxing. The process can be painful but quick. Waxing can be an expensive beauty maintenance. It is not permanent hair removal solution, so return visits to wax the eyebrows will be needed. Irritation is sometimes experienced in the area that is waxed.

Slight pain or tiny red bumps may be visible, but this will heal within a few hours to a day. These drawbacks are not always experienced but should be considered when deciding if eyebrow waxing is the right form of hair removal.
